Nov 22, 2010 · Now we can discuss magnetite. Magnetite (Fe 3 O 4) is also a common ore of iron but, unlike hematite, it contains both oxidation states of iron so can be called iron(II,III) oxide or ferrousferric oxide and the formula can also be written as FeO • Fe 2 O 3. where the FeO is ferrous iron (Fe 2+) and the Fe 2 O 3 is ferric iron (Fe 3+).
What is iron ore? Iron ores are rocks and minerals from which metallic iron can be extracted. There are four main types of iron ore deposit: massive hematite, which is the most commonly mined, magnetite, titanomagnetite, and pisolitic ironstone. These ores vary in colour from dark grey, bright yellow, or deep purple to rusty red.

Dec 01, 2015 · Reduction procedure. Industrially iron is produced from iron ores, principally hematite (Fe 2 O 3), magnetite (Fe 3 O 4) by a carbothermic reaction that is reduction with carbon, in a blast furnace at temperatures about 800–1,600° the blast furnace, iron ore, carbon in the form of coke, and a flux such as limestone are fed into the top of the furnace, .

Use of Magnetite as an Ore of Iron. Most of the iron ore mined today is a banded sedimentary rock known as taconite that contains a mixture of magnetite, hematite, and chert. Once considered a waste material, taconite became an important ore after higher grade deposits were depleted. Today's commercial taconites contain 25 to 30% iron by weight.
Iron ore is any rock or mineral from which iron can economically be extracted. It comes in a variety of colors, including dark gray, bright yellow, deep purple, and rusty red. The iron comes in the form of iron oxides such as magnetite, hematite, limonite, goethite, or siderite. Economically viable forms of ore contain between 25% and 60% iron.
Dec 01, 2016 · The pelletisation study of magnetite iron ore fines starts with green balling using limestone and bentonite as additives. Heating cycle of iron ore pellets is one of the prime segments of the whole pelletisation process. Drying, preheating, firing and cooling processes are collectively named as heating cycle of the process. A temperature profile is maintained throughout the induration process ...

Jul 20, 2013 · Ground magnetic surveys map the magnetism of underlying rocks. The most common magnetic minerals found are pyrrhotite, (iron sulphide), and magnetite. Magnetite when found with sufficient purity and quantity may become an iron ore deposit. Pyrrhotite is important because of the minerals it's often associated with including pyrite, another ...

The typical magnetite iron ore concentrate has less than % phosphorus, 37% silica and less than 3% aluminum. The grain size of the magnetite and its degree of comingling with the silica groundmass determine the grind size to which the rock must be reduced to enable efficient magnetic separation to provide a high purity magnetite concentrate ...
